Web1 hour ago · One-third of DBS surgeries were performed in Parkinson’s patients 70 years or older, 30% of whom were women. Nationwide data identified 3,000 essential tremor patients who underwent DBS — 42.6% were women. Moreover, women comprised 44% of those 70 or older treated with DBS for essential tremors. WebDeep brain stimulation (DBS) is a surgery to implant electrodes in targeted areas within your brain. These electrodes provide electrical pulses in your brain. They are connected to a small device (called a pulse generator or neurostimulator) that is implanted under your skin, below your collarbone.
